Certificate in SAS Programming

SAS (Statistical Analysis System) programming involves using the SAS software suite to perform various data management, analysis, and reporting tasks. SAS programming is widely used in industries such as healthcare, finance, and market research for its powerful data processing capabilities. It allows users to manipulate data, perform statistical analysis, and generate reports efficiently. SAS programming is known for its versatility, as it can handle large datasets and complex analyses with ease. It also offers a wide range of statistical procedures and data visualization tools, making it a valuable tool for data-driven decision-making.

Why is SAS Programming important?

  • Data Management: SAS Programming is widely used for data cleaning, transformation, and integration tasks, ensuring data quality and consistency.
  • Statistical Analysis: SAS offers a comprehensive suite of statistical procedures for analyzing data, including descriptive statistics, hypothesis testing, and regression analysis.
  • Business Intelligence: SAS Programming is used for creating reports, dashboards, and data visualizations to provide actionable insights for business decision-making.
  • Predictive Modeling: SAS is known for its advanced predictive modeling capabilities, allowing users to build and validate predictive models for forecasting and risk analysis.
  • Big Data Analytics: SAS can handle large datasets efficiently, making it suitable for big data analytics tasks such as data mining and machine learning.
  • Healthcare Analytics: SAS is widely used in healthcare for analyzing patient data, clinical trials, and health outcomes to improve patient care and outcomes.
  • Finance and Banking: SAS is used in finance and banking for risk management, fraud detection, and customer analytics to enhance business performance and security.
  • Market Research: SAS is used in market research for analyzing consumer behavior, market trends, and competitive intelligence to drive marketing strategies.
  • Regulatory Compliance: SAS is used in industries such as pharmaceuticals, finance, and healthcare to ensure compliance with regulatory requirements through data analysis and reporting.
  • Academic Research: SAS is used in academic research for conducting statistical analyses, data mining, and research studies across various disciplines.

A SAS (Statistical Analysis System) programmer is an IT professional who focuses on data assortment and analysis. SAS programmers aggregate data and manipulate it for the purpose of analyzing current projects and efficiency, as well as foreseeing future trends and needs.
